SERVES: 2
PREP TIME: 20 mins
COOK TIME: 20 mins
- 500g raw papaya (skin removed and diced)
- 1 medium onion (finely chopped)
- 1 tomato (finely chopped)
- 2 green chilies (slit in half)
- 3 garlic cloves (pounded)
- 1 small ginger (pounded)
- 1 tsp turmeric powder
- 1 tsp red chili powder
- 1 tbsp garam masala
- 1 tsp mustard seeds
- 1 tsp cumin seeds
- curry leaves
- coriander leaves
- salt
- oil
1. Make sabzi: Add some oil in a kadai and heated, add some mustard seeds, cumin seeds and curry leaves and stir them for few seconds. Now, add the crushed ginger & garlic, onions and green chilies and cook them till the onions are caramelized. Add the tomatoes, turmeric powder, red chili powder with little water and cook this till you see the oil being separated from the masala. Once you see this happening add the cut papaya and mix it well with the masala. Now add salt and some garam masala. Cover and cook for 15 mins. Stir occasionally. Garnish with some curry leaves and coriander leaves.
